A Lifelong Commitment to Healing

With trained, practised and disciplined sensitivity and a wealth of experience, I’m here to accompany and support you through life's challenges.

Over nearly two decades, I've dedicated myself to supporting individuals across South East Queensland, Australia, and beyond, fostering compassion and understanding in communities along the way.

As a lifelong learner, I continue to expand my skills through ongoing education, including a Master of Psychotherapy.

Qualifications

  • Master of Narrative Therapy and Community Work (qualifying)

  • Bachelor of Peace and Conflict Studies & International Relations

  • Graduate Certificate in Community Development

  • Graduate Certificate in Early Childhood Learning and Development

  • Registered with the Australian Counselling Association (10145)

My approach to therapy integrates various disciplines, including interpersonal neurobiology, psychological, sociological and political sciences, narrative and trauma-responsive practices.

With a focus on nurturing your unique needs and experiences, I weave together multi-disciplinary wisdom to support your healing journey.
